Google starts utilizing maker learning to aid with spell check at scale in Search.

Google launches Google Translate using machine finding out to automatically equate languages, beginning with Arabic-English and English-Arabic.

A new age of AI begins when Google scientists enhance speech acknowledgment with Deep Neural Networks, which is a brand-new maker finding out architecture loosely imitated the neural structures in the human brain.

In the famous "cat paper," Google Research starts using large sets of "unlabeled information," like videos and pictures from the web, to considerably improve AI image classification. Roughly comparable to human learning, the neural network acknowledges images (consisting of felines!) from exposure rather of direct guideline.

Introduced in the research paper "Distributed Representations of Words and Phrases and their Compositionality," Word2Vec catalyzed basic development in natural language processing-- going on to be cited more than 40,000 times in the decade following, and winning the NeurIPS 2023 "Test of Time" Award.

AtariDQN is the very first Deep Learning design to effectively discover control policies straight from high-dimensional sensory input using support learning. It played Atari video games from simply the raw pixel input at a level that superpassed a human professional.

Google provides Sequence To Sequence Learning With Neural Networks, an effective machine learning method that can learn to equate languages and summarize text by reading words one at a time and remembering what it has checked out previously.

Google obtains DeepMind, one of the leading AI research laboratories on the planet.

Google releases RankBrain in Search and Ads offering a better understanding of how words associate with principles.

Distillation enables complex designs to run in production by reducing their size and latency, while keeping most of the performance of bigger, more computationally costly designs. It has been used to improve Google Search and Smart Summary for Gmail, Chat, Docs, and more.

At its yearly I/O designers conference, Google presents Google Photos, a brand-new app that utilizes AI with search capability to look for and gain access to your memories by the individuals, places, and things that matter.

Google presents TensorFlow, a new, scalable open source maker learning structure utilized in speech recognition.

Google Research proposes a brand-new, decentralized technique to training AI called Federated Learning that assures enhanced security and scalability.

AlphaGo, a computer system program developed by DeepMind, plays the legendary Lee Sedol, winner of 18 world titles, famous for his creativity and commonly considered to be among the best players of the previous years. During the video games, AlphaGo played a number of innovative winning relocations. In game 2, it played Move 37 - an innovative relocation assisted AlphaGo win the game and upended centuries of conventional wisdom.

Google openly announces the Tensor Processing Unit (TPU), custom information center silicon developed specifically for artificial intelligence. After that statement, the TPU continues to gain momentum:

- • TPU v2 is revealed in 2017

- • TPU v3 is announced at I/O 2018

- • TPU v4 is announced at I/O 2021

- • At I/O 2022, Sundar announces the world's biggest, publicly-available device learning center, powered by TPU v4 pods and based at our data center in Mayes County, Oklahoma, which works on 90% carbon-free energy.

Developed by researchers at DeepMind, WaveNet is a brand-new deep neural network for creating raw audio waveforms enabling it to model natural sounding speech. WaveNet was utilized to design much of the voices of the Google Assistant and other Google services.

Google reveals the Google Neural Machine Translation system (GNMT), which uses advanced training techniques to attain the biggest improvements to date for machine translation quality.

In a paper published in the Journal of the American Medical Association, Google shows that a machine-learning driven system for identifying diabetic retinopathy from a retinal image could carry out on-par with board-certified eye doctors.

Google launches "Attention Is All You Need," a research study paper that presents the Transformer, an unique neural network architecture especially well fit for language understanding, among lots of other things.

Introduced DeepVariant, an open-source genomic variant caller that significantly enhances the precision of identifying alternative places. This development in Genomics has added to the fastest ever human genome sequencing, and assisted develop the world's very first human pangenome reference.

Google Research releases JAX - a Python library created for high-performance numerical computing, specifically device discovering research study.

Google reveals Smart Compose, a new feature in Gmail that uses AI to assist users faster respond to their email. Smart Compose constructs on Smart Reply, another AI feature.

Google releases its AI Principles - a set of guidelines that the company follows when developing and hb9lc.org using . The principles are developed to make sure that AI is utilized in a method that is advantageous to society and aspects human rights.

Google introduces a new technique for natural language processing pre-training called Bidirectional Encoder Representations from Transformers (BERT), assisting Search better understand users' inquiries.

AlphaZero, a basic support finding out algorithm, masters chess, shogi, and Go through self-play.

Google's Quantum AI demonstrates for the very first time a computational task that can be executed greatly quicker on a quantum processor garagesale.es than on the world's fastest classical computer-- just 200 seconds on a quantum processor compared to the 10,000 years it would take on a classical gadget.

Google Research proposes using device discovering itself to help in creating computer chip hardware to accelerate the design process.

DeepMind's AlphaFold is acknowledged as a service to the 50-year "protein-folding issue." AlphaFold can precisely forecast 3D designs of protein structures and is accelerating research in biology. This work went on to get a Nobel Prize in Chemistry in 2024.

At I/O 2021, Google announces MUM, multimodal designs that are 1,000 times more powerful than BERT and allow individuals to naturally ask questions across different kinds of details.

At I/O 2021, Google reveals LaMDA, a brand-new conversational innovation short for "Language Model for Dialogue Applications."

Google reveals Tensor, a custom-made System on a Chip (SoC) designed to bring innovative AI experiences to Pixel users.

At I/O 2022, Sundar announces PaLM - or Pathways Language Model - Google's biggest language model to date, trained on 540 billion criteria.

Sundar reveals LaMDA 2, Google's most advanced conversational AI design.

Google announces Imagen and Parti, two models that utilize different techniques to generate photorealistic images from a text description.

The AlphaFold Database-- that included over 200 million proteins structures and nearly all cataloged proteins known to science-- is launched.

Google announces Phenaki, a model that can generate realistic videos from text triggers.

Google developed Med-PaLM, a clinically fine-tuned LLM, which was the first design to attain a passing score on a medical licensing exam-style question criteria, demonstrating its capability to accurately respond to medical questions.

Google introduces MusicLM, an AI design that can create music from text.

Google's Quantum AI attains the world's very first demonstration of decreasing mistakes in a quantum processor by increasing the number of qubits.

Google releases Bard, an early experiment that lets people team up with generative AI, first in the US and UK - followed by other nations.

DeepMind and Google's Brain team combine to form Google DeepMind.

Google launches PaLM 2, our next generation large language model, that constructs on Google's tradition of development research in artificial intelligence and accountable AI.

GraphCast, an AI design for faster and more accurate worldwide weather condition forecasting, is presented.

GNoME - a deep knowing tool - is utilized to discover 2.2 million new crystals, consisting of 380,000 steady products that might power future innovations.

Google presents Gemini, our most capable and general model, constructed from the ground up to be multimodal. Gemini has the ability to generalize and perfectly understand, operate throughout, and combine different types of details including text, code, audio, image and video.

Google expands the Gemini ecosystem to introduce a new generation: Gemini 1.5, and brings Gemini to more items like Gmail and Docs. Gemini Advanced introduced, offering individuals access to Google's most capable AI designs.

Gemma is a family of light-weight state-of-the art open designs developed from the exact same research and innovation utilized to create the Gemini designs.

Introduced AlphaFold 3, a new AI model developed by Google DeepMind and Isomorphic Labs that predicts the structure of proteins, DNA, RNA, ligands and more. Scientists can access the bulk of its abilities, totally free, through AlphaFold Server.

Google Research and Harvard released the very first synaptic-resolution restoration of the human brain. This achievement, enabled by the fusion of scientific imaging and Google's AI algorithms, paves the way for discoveries about brain function.

NeuralGCM, a brand-new device learning-based method to imitating Earth's atmosphere, is presented. Developed in collaboration with the European Centre for Medium-Range Weather Report (ECMWF), NeuralGCM integrates traditional physics-based modeling with ML for enhanced simulation accuracy and efficiency.

Our combined AlphaProof and AlphaGeometry 2 systems solved 4 out of six issues from the 2024 International Mathematical Olympiad (IMO), attaining the exact same level as a silver medalist in the competitors for the very first time. The IMO is the oldest, largest and most distinguished competitors for young mathematicians, and has also become extensively acknowledged as a grand difficulty in artificial intelligence.
